Bibiana Martina Olama Mangue (born 2 December 1982) is an Equatorial Guinean former athlete. She competed at the 2012 Summer Olympics in the 100 metres hurdles event.[1] She was flag bearer for the Equatorial Guinea team.[2] She also competed in heptathlons.[3]
